
对于运行Oracle Real Application Clusters(RAC)环境的大型企业而言,数据的安全性和完整性更是至关重要
RAC作为Oracle提供的一种高可用性和高性能的数据库解决方案,能够在多节点上并行处理数据库请求,极大地提升了业务系统的处理能力和容错能力
然而,即便是在如此强大的技术架构下,数据的备份与恢复仍然是不可忽视的关键环节
本文将深入探讨RAC Oracle逻辑备份文件的重要性、实施策略、最佳实践以及面临的挑战与解决方案,旨在为企业构建一道确保数据安全的坚实防线
一、RAC Oracle逻辑备份文件的重要性 逻辑备份,与物理备份相对,是指通过导出数据库的结构和数据到文件的形式进行的备份
在RAC环境中,逻辑备份文件不仅关乎数据的恢复能力,还直接影响到业务的连续性和数据的完整性
1.数据恢复的高效性:逻辑备份文件包含了数据库的DDL(数据定义语言)和DML(数据操作语言)语句,可以快速重建数据库对象并恢复数据
相比物理备份,逻辑备份在特定数据恢复场景下(如仅恢复部分表或用户数据)更为灵活高效
2.跨平台兼容性:逻辑备份文件是文本格式,具有良好的跨平台兼容性,便于在不同操作系统或Oracle版本间迁移数据
这对于企业升级系统或调整IT架构尤为重要
3.数据安全性的增强:定期执行逻辑备份,结合适当的存储管理策略,可以形成数据的历史快照,为灾难恢复提供额外的安全保障
即使物理存储发生故障,也能从逻辑备份中恢复数据
二、实施策略与工具选择 在RAC环境下执行逻辑备份,需要精心策划,选择合适的工具和策略,以确保备份过程的稳定性和效率
1.工具选择:Oracle提供了多种逻辑备份工具,其中最常用的是`exp`/`imp`(传统导出/导入工具)和`expdp`/`impdp`(Data Pump导出/导入工具)
Data Pump作为较新的技术,提供了更高的性能、更多的灵活性和更强的错误处理能力,是RAC环境下逻辑备份的首选工具
2.备份策略:制定全面的备份策略,包括全库备份、增量备份、差异备份等,以满足不同恢复需求
同时,应考虑备份窗口的选择,避免对业务高峰时段的影响
对于RAC环境,可以利用服务窗口或负载均衡机制,将备份任务分散到非活跃节点执行
3.并行处理:利用Data Pump的并行处理能力,可以显著提高备份和恢复速度
通过设置合理的并行度,可以有效利用RAC集群的计算资源,缩短备份时间
三、最佳实践 为了确保RAC Oracle逻辑备份的有效性和可靠性,以下是一些最佳实践建议: 1.定期验证备份文件:备份完成后,应定期验证备份文件的有效性和可恢复性
这可以通过在测试环境中执行导入操作来实现,确保在真正需要恢复时不会遇到意外问题
2.存储管理:将备份文件存储在安全可靠的位置,如磁带库、云存储或专用的备份服务器上
同时,实施备份文件的版本控制和生命周期管理,定期清理过期备份,避免存储空间的无谓消耗
3.监控与报警:建立备份作业的监控机制,实时跟踪备份进度和状态
对于失败的备份任务,应立即触发报警,以便快速响应和处理
4.文档化:详细记录备份策略、步骤、工具配置等关键信息,形成文档
这有助于团队成员理解和维护备份流程,确保在人员变动时备份工作的连续性
四、面临的挑战与解决方案 尽管逻辑备份在RAC环境中扮演着重要角色,但在实际操作中仍面临一些挑战: 1.性能影响:尽管Data Pump提供了并行处理能力,但在大规模数据库上进行逻辑备份仍可能对系统性能造成一定影响
解决方案包括在非业务高峰时段执行备份、优化并行度设置以及利用快照技术减少I/O负载
2.备份窗口限制:对于24小时不间断运行的关键业务系统,找到合适的备份窗口可能是一项挑战
通过采用增量备份和差异备份策略,结合快速恢复技术,可以缩短备份窗口,减少对业务的影响
3.数据一致性:在RAC环境中,确保备份过程中数据的一致性尤为关键
利用Oracle提供的挂起/恢复会话功能,可以在备份开始前暂停所有DML操作,确保备份数据的一致性
此外,Data Pump也提供了元数据一致性检查机制,进一步增强备份数据的可靠性
五、结语 RAC Oracle逻辑备份文件作为数据安全防护体系中的重要一环,其有效实施对于保障企业数据资产的完整性和业务连续性至关重要
通过选择合适的备份工具、制定合理的备份策略、遵循最佳实践以及积极应对挑战,企业可以构建起一道坚实的数据安全防线
在这个过程中,持续的监控、验证和优化是确保备份工作高效、可靠运行的关键
未来,随着技术的不断进步和数据量的持续增长,对RAC Oracle逻辑备份的研究与实践将更加深入,为企业的数字化转型之路提供更加坚实的支撑
备份文件后,一键清空电脑数据指南
掌握RAC Oracle逻辑备份文件:高效管理与保护数据策略
戴尔电脑备份文件快速恢复指南
精简备份GHO文件,高效存储秘诀
电脑备份文件最佳存放位置指南
Maya崩溃后,备份文件寻找指南
Win10未备份?找回桌面文件绝招!
Linux配置文件备份命令大全
轻松掌握:全面指南教你如何备份应用文件
掌握文件增量备份,高效数据管理秘籍
轻松掌握:如何下载并妥善保存备份文件的步骤指南
掌握技巧:高效管理用友系统备份与压缩文件策略
掌握文件备份:高效使用cp命令技巧
UltraEdit备份文件实用指南:轻松掌握数据安全技巧
掌握技巧:个所文件高效备份方法与步骤详解
2014CAD激活备份文件夹:高效管理秘籍
高效安全!掌握私密文件备份的绝佳方法
掌握icacls备份文件解读技巧
掌握技巧:如何利用.exe文件进行高效数据备份